How they compare

Saint Kitts and Nevis currently reports 10.61 units per square kilometre against 9.86 units per square kilometre in Romania, a difference of 0.75 units per square kilometre.

That makes Saint Kitts and Nevis's figure about 1.1 times Romania's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Saint Kitts and Nevis ahead.

Romania ranks 72nd and Saint Kitts and Nevis ranks 69th of 215 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Romania averaged higher in 2 and Saint Kitts and Nevis in 5.
